1. 15-Minute Honey Garlic Butter Salmon

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ets (skin-on), 2 tbsp butter, 2 tbsp honey, 4 cloves garlic (minced), 1 tbsp soy sauce, 1 tbsp lemon juice, 1 tbsp olive oil, salt & pepper.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Season salmon fillets generously on both sides with salt and pepper.
  2. Heat olive oil in a pan over medium-high heat. Place salmon skin-side up and sear for 4 minutes until golden, then flip.
  3. Add butter and minced garlic to the pan, cooking for 1 minute until fragrant.
  4. Whisk honey, soy sauce, and lemon juice together in a small bowl, then pour into the skillet around the salmon.
  5. Spoon the bubbling sauce repeatedly over the fillets for 2 minutes until the glazes thickens and salmon is cooked through.

2. Easy Sheet Pan Lemon Herb Salmon and Asparagus

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 1 lb fresh asparagus (woody ends trimmed), 2 tbsp olive oil, 2 cloves garlic (minced), 1 tsp dried oregano, 1 lemon (sliced), salt & pepper.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a large ba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. Arrange salmon fillets and trimmed asparagus side-by-side on the tray.
  3. Drizzle olive oil over both the salmon and asparagus, then sprinkle with minced garlic, oregano, salt, and pepper.
  4. Top each salmon fillet with a thin lemon slice.
  5. Roast for 12–15 minutes until the salmon flakes easily with a fork and asparagus is tender-crisp.

3. Crispy Air Fryer Salmon Fillets

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 1 tbsp olive oil,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p paprika, 1/2 tsp onion powder, 1/2 tsp salt, 1/4 tsp black pepper, lemon wedges.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Preheat your air fryer to 390°F (200°C).
  2. Pat salmon fillets completely dry with paper towels and brush all sides with olive oil.
  3. Mix garlic powder, paprika, onion powder, salt, and black pepper in a small bowl, then rub evenly over the salmon.
  4. Place fillets skin-side down in the air fryer basket in a single layer (do not overcrowd).
  5. Air fry for 7–9 minutes depending on thickness. Serve immediately with lemon wedges.

4. Creamy Tuscan Garlic Butter Salmon

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 1 tbsp olive oil, 2 tbsp butter, 4 cloves garlic (minced), 1/2 cup heavy cream, 1/3 cup chicken broth, 1/2 cup sun-dried tomatoes (chopped), 2 cups fresh baby spinach, 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Sear salmon for 4 minutes per side until cooked; remove and set aside.
  2. Melt butter in the same pan, then sauté garlic for 1 minute.
  3. Pour in chicken broth and heavy cream; bring to a gentle simmer.
  4. Stir in sun-dried tomatoes, Parmesan cheese, and fresh spinach. Cook for 2–3 minutes until spinach wilts and sauce thickens.
  5. Return salmon fillets to the skillet, spooning the creamy sauce over top before serving.

5. Sweet and Sticky Glazed Teriyaki Salmon Bowls

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ets (cubed into 1-inch pieces), 1/3 cup teriyaki sauce, 1 tbsp honey, 1 tsp sesame oil, 1 tbsp olive oil, 2 cups cooked white rice, 1 cup steamed broccoli, sesame seeds & green onions.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Whisk teriyaki sauce, honey, and sesame oil together in a bowl.
  2.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Add salmon cubes and sear for 3–4 minutes until golden on all sides.
  3. Pour the teriyaki glaze over the salmon cubes, tossing gently for 1–2 minutes until sticky and coated.
  4. Assemble bowls by placing 1/2 cup cooked rice and steamed broccoli at the base.
  5. Top with teriyaki salmon cubes and garnish with sesame seeds and green onions.

6. Creamy Dill and Lemon Baked Salmon

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 1/3 cup sour cream or Greek yogurt, 1 tbsp fresh dill (chopped), 1 tbsp lemon juice, 1 tsp lemon zest, 1 clove garlic (minced), salt & pepper.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a baking sheet.
  2. In a small bowl, combine sour cream, fresh dill, lemon juice, lemon zest, minced garlic, salt, and pepper.
  3. Place salmon fillets on the prepared baking sheet and season lightly with salt.
  4. Spread a generous layer of the creamy dill mixture evenly over the top of each fillet.
  5. Bake for 12–15 minutes until salmon is cooked through and top is warm and set.

7. Crispy Sweet Chili Pan-Seared Salmon

Ingredients: 4 skin-on salmon fillets, 1 tbsp olive oil, 1/3 cup sweet chili sauce, 1 tbsp soy sauce, 1 tsp lime juice, 1 tsp fresh ginger (grated).

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Whisk sweet chili sauce, soy sauce, lime juice, and grated ginger together in a small bowl.
  2. Heat olive oil in a non-stick skillet over medium-high heat until hot.
  3. Place salmon skin-side down and press firmly for 10 seconds. Sear for 5 minutes until skin is super crispy.
  4. Flip salmon, pour the sweet chili glaze into the pan, and simmer for 2 minutes as the sauce caramelizes around the fish.
  5. Remove from heat and serve warm with extra sauce drizzled over top.

8. Foil Packet Baked Salmon with Garlic and Butter

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 4 tbsp butter (sliced into pats), 4 cloves garlic (minced), 1 tbsp fresh parsley (chopped), 1 lemon (sliced), salt & pepper.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C) and cut 4 large sheets of aluminum foil.
  2. Place one salmon fillet in the center of each foil sheet and season with salt and pepper.
  3. Top each fillet with minced garlic, 1 tbsp of butter pats, 1 lemon slice, and chopped parsley.
  4. Fold the edges of the foil up and over the salmon to create completely sealed packets.
  5. Place packets on a baking sheet and bake for 12–15 minutes. Carefully open packets to serve.

9. Blackened Cajun Salmon with Mango Salsa

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 1 tbsp olive oil, 1 tbsp Cajun seasoning, 1 cup fresh mango (diced), 1/2 cup red bell pepper (diced), 1/4 cup red onion (diced), 2 tbsp cilantro (chopped), 1 tbsp lime juice.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Mix diced mango, bell pepper, red onion, cilantro, and lime juice in a bowl to make the salsa; chill in fridge.
  2. Coat salmon fillets with olive oil and press Cajun seasoning firmly into both sides of the fish.
  3. Heat a cast-iron skillet over high heat until smoking.
  4. Add salmon and cook for 3–4 minutes per side until a dark, flavorful crust forms.
  5. Transfer cooked salmon to plates and top generously with cold mango salsa.

10. Healthy Maple Mustard Glazed Salmon

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 2 tbsp pure maple syrup, 2 tbsp Whole Grain or Dijon mustard, 1 tbsp soy sauce, 1 clove garlic (minced), salt & pepper.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king dish with foil.
  2. Whisk maple syrup, Dijon mustard, soy sauce, and minced garlic in a bowl.
  3. Place salmon fillets in the baking dish and season lightly with salt and pepper.
  4. Brush 3/4 of the maple mustard glaze generously over the tops of the fillets.
  5. Bake for 12–14 minutes, brushing with remaining glaze during the last 2 minutes of cooking.

11. Crispy Parmesan Herb Crust Baked Salmon

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 1/3 cup grated Parmesan cheese, 1/4 cup panko breadcrumbs, 1 tbsp olive oil, 1 tbsp fresh parsley (chopped), 1/2 tsp garlic powder, salt & pepper.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. Mix Parmesan cheese, panko breadcrumbs, olive oil, parsley, garlic powder, salt, and pepper in a small bowl until crumbly.
  3. Place salmon fillets on the baking sheet and pat dry.
  4. Press a generous amount of the Parmesan crumb mixture onto the top of each fillet to coat evenly.
  5. Bake for 12–15 minutes until the topping turns golden-brown and crispy and salmon is cooked through.

12. Mediterranean Baked Salmon with Olives and Tomatoes

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 1 cup cherry tomatoes (halved), 1/2 cup Kalamata olives (pitted and sliced), 2 tbsp capers, 2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il, 2 cloves garlic (minced), 1 tsp dried oregano.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and grease a baking dish.
  2. Toss cherry tomatoes, olives, capers, olive oil, garlic, and oregano together in a bowl.
  3. Arrange salmon fillets in the baking dish and season with salt and pepper.
  4. Spoon the Mediterranean tomato-olive mixture around and over the salmon.
  5. Bake for 15–18 minutes until tomatoes burst and salmon is flaky.

13. Spicy Sriracha Mayo Baked Salmon

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 1/4 cup mayonnaise, 1.5 tbsp Sriracha sauce, 1 tsp lime juice, 1 tsp soy sauce, green onions & sesame seeds for garnish.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king pan.
  2. Stir mayonnaise, Sriracha, lime juice, and soy sauce together in a bowl until smooth.
  3. Place salmon fillets skin-side down on the baking pan.
  4. Spread a thick layer of spicy Sriracha mayo over the top surface of each fillet.
  5. Bake for 12–14 minutes, then broil on high for 1–2 minutes to lightly brown the top. Garnish with green onions.

14. 20-Minute Creamy Spinach and Artichoke Salmon

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 1 tbsp olive oil, 1 cup canned artichoke hearts (chopped), 2 cups fresh spinach, 1/2 cup cream cheese (softened), 1/4 cup milk, 1/4 cup Parmesan, 2 cloves garlic.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Sear salmon for 4 minutes per side; remove from pan.
  2. Reduce heat to medium, add minced garlic, spinach, and artichokes, cooking for 2 minutes until spinach wilts.
  3. Stir in cream cheese, milk, and Parmesan cheese until melted and a smooth sauce forms.
  4. Return salmon fillets back into the skillet, spooning the warm spinach-artichoke sauce over top.
  5. Simmer for 2 minutes until everything is thoroughly heated.

15. Miso Glazed Salmon (Japanese Restaurant Style)

Ingredients: 4 salmon fillets, 2 tbsp white miso paste, 1 tbsp mirin, 1 tbsp sake or rice vinegar, 1 tbsp brown sugar, 1 tsp soy sauce, 1 tsp sesame oil.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Whisk white miso paste, mirin, sake, brown sugar, soy sauce, and sesame oil in a small bowl until completely smooth.
  2. Coat salmon fillets with the miso glaze and let marinate for at least 15 minutes.
  3. Set your oven broiler to HIGH and place an oven rack 6 inches from the heat element.
  4. Place marinated salmon on a foil-lined baking sheet.
  5. Broil for 6–8 minutes, watching closely until the miso glaze bubbles, caramelizes, and chars slightly at the edges.
